What is Sucralfate 1gm?
Sucralfate 1gm is a prescription medication used to treat and prevent ulcers in the stomach and intestines. It works by forming a protective barrier over the ulcer, helping it heal and preventing further damage from stomach acid. This medication is often prescribed for people with gastric ulcers, duodenal ulcers, or acid reflux issues. It is not absorbed into the bloodstream, making it a safe choice for most people.
How to Use Sucralfate 1gm
Take Sucralfate 1gm on an empty stomach, usually one hour before meals or at bedtime, as directed by your doctor. Avoid eating or drinking anything for at least 30 minutes after taking it to allow the medication to coat the stomach properly. It comes in tablet or liquid form. If using the liquid, shake well before use. Follow your doctor’s instructions to get the best results.
Dosage Instructions
The standard dose for adults is one gram four times a day. Your doctor may adjust the dosage based on the severity of your condition. For best results, continue taking the medication even if you feel better. Do not exceed the recommended dose or stop treatment without consulting your doctor. Children’s doses vary and must be determined by a healthcare provider.
Side Effects
Common side effects of Sucralfate 1gm include constipation, dry mouth, and mild stomach upset. Serious side effects are rare but can include allergic reactions, difficulty breathing, or severe stomach pain. If you experience any unusual symptoms, contact your doctor immediately. Staying hydrated and eating a fiber-rich diet can help reduce constipation.
Drug Interactions
Sucralfate 1gm may interact with antacids, certain antibiotics, or other medications by reducing their absorption. To avoid interactions, take Sucralfate 1gm at least two hours before or after other medicines. Inform your doctor about all the medications and supplements you are currently taking.
Warnings
People with kidney problems, diabetes, or difficulty swallowing should consult their doctor before taking Sucralfate 1gm. Pregnant or breastfeeding women should use this medication only if clearly needed. Do not chew or crush the tablets, as it may reduce their effectiveness. Avoid smoking and alcohol, as these can delay healing.
Storage
Store Sucralfate 1gm at room temperature, away from moisture, heat, and direct sunlight. Keep the medication in its original container and tightly closed when not in use. Ensure it is out of reach of children and pets. Do not use it past the expiration date.

What cannot be taken with Sucralfate 1gm?
Avoid taking antacids within 30 minutes of Sucralfate 1gm, as they can interfere with its effectiveness. Also, certain antibiotics, like ciprofloxacin, should not be taken at the same time. Consult your doctor for a full list of restrictions.
How long does it take for Sucralfate 1gm to work?
Sucralfate 1gm begins forming a protective barrier almost immediately. However, it may take 4–8 weeks to heal ulcers fully. Follow your doctor’s advice and complete the treatment for best results.
Can I go to bed after taking Sucralfate 1gm?
Yes, you can go to bed after taking Sucralfate 1gm, especially if it’s your bedtime dose. Just ensure you’ve taken it on an empty stomach, and avoid eating or drinking anything for at least 30 minutes.
